Netsweeper Inc. Appoints Andrew Coutts as President for Global Operations

Andrew Coutts accepts the role of President at Netsweeper Inc., a global Internet Content Filtering software organization that empowers organizations to guard against Internet threats and to offer Internet end users a secure, productive Internet experience, protected from harmful, malicious and inappropriate content.

Guelph, ON (Issues Wire / PRWEB) March 18, 2008 -- Netsweeper Inc. is pleased to announce that Andrew Coutts has accepted the role of President for its global operations.

"I am excited to announce Andrew's arrival at Netsweeper. With the Internet content filtering industry in growth mode and numerous international opportunities on the horizon, it is imperative that we add the minds of proven leaders to our team," said Perry Roach, co-founder and CEO of Netsweeper. "Andrew brings with him an abundance of experience that will positively impact every aspect of our business by ensuring that we are doing the right things to succeed as a global enterprise."

Andrew joins Netsweeper with over 25 years of progressive and executive experience in the software and technology industry. His career began at Software AG where Andrew advanced through the ranks, ultimately leading operations in North America as the COO. In 1999, Andrew accepted the role of President and CEO at Databeacon, an Ottawa-based start-up in the field of business intelligence. For the past two years, Andrew has held the position of President for Next Analytics before making the decision to move over to Netsweeper Inc.

"I elected to join Netsweeper due to the tremendous opportunity this business possesses in a market that is gaining significant international awareness. I am also fortunate to have inherited such a strong team that truly has the heart and desire to contribute to the growth and success of the business," said Andrew.

Andrew will be responsible for managing the day-to-ay operations of the business with the assistance of the senior management team in place. Perry Roach will remain CEO and will focus on international opportunities while leading the sales division.

About Netsweeper, Inc.:
Netsweeper Inc. empowers organizations to guard against Internet abuse and to offer their end users a secure, productive Internet experience, protected from harmful, malicious and inappropriate content. Netsweeper provides intelligent, network and workstation based web filtering technology to corporations, Internet service providers, educational institutions, government organizations and OEM partners around the world. Since its inception in 1999, Netsweeper has grown dramatically with offices and distribution channels now located in the United Kingdom, the United States, Canada, South America, and South Africa.
